Large-scale pathology foundation models show promise on a variety of cancer-related tasks
Microsoft Research Blog - Microsoft Research
Microsoft researchers collaborated to release new pathology foundation models. Their report shows models benefit from diverse data, increased model size, and specialized algorithms to enhance the accuracy and applicability of cancer diagnosis and treatment. GENEVA uses large language models for interactive game narrative design
Microsoft Research Blog - Microsoft Research
Designed for interactive storytelling in games, GENEVA lets users explore narrative paths and adapt stories to diverse contexts. It uses LLMs to generate and visualize branching narratives from high-level descriptions, representing them as graphs.
